Each of his classes ranged from $300-$400! Let's see. Let me pull his papers out. (I have to gather them up anyway to tell this realtor he may work for what classes he's done).
What I could find was that he took Residential Valuation I which was $400 for 30hrs. Valuation II was $400 for 30 hrs. Valuation III was $410 for 15hrs, USPAP was $285 for 15hrs and I think he still needs some other piddly other course yet which can be anything from Realestate to Contruction stuff. Does that sound right? He needs 15 more hrs and then he's then done. So I guess it wasn't quite $3,000. When all's said and done it's close to $2,000. Still WAY more than $900!!!! From what I understand, in Pennsylvania there are only like 3 Realtors that offer this course. There is no Appraiser schools around here. Some people traveled 3hrs 2 times a week to come to the class that my husband went to.
